If weather conditions are not a factor, the driver should

examine the windshield and the camera located on the

back side of the inside rear view mirror. They may

require cleaning or removal of an obstruction.
When the condition that created limited functionality is

no longer present, the system will return to full function-

ality.
NOTE:

If the “ACC/FCW Limited Functionality Clean

Front Windshield” message occurs frequently (e.g. more

than once on every trip) without any snow, rain, mud, or

other obstruction, have the windshield and forward

facing camera inspected at your authorized dealer.

Service ACC/FCW Warning
If the system turns off, and the DID displays “ACC/FCW

Unavailable Service Required” or “Cruise/FCW Unavail-

able Service Required”, there may be an internal system

fault or a temporary malfunction that limits ACC func-

tionality. Although the vehicle is still drivable under

normal conditions, ACC will be temporarily unavailable.

If this occurs, try activating ACC again later, following an

ignition cycle. If the problem persists, see your autho-

rized dealer.

Precautions While Driving With ACC

In certain driving situations, ACC may have detection

issues. In these cases, ACC may brake late or unexpect-

edly. The driver needs to stay alert and may need to

intervene.
Towing A Trailer
Towing a trailer is not advised when using ACC.
